Ukrainian drones struck the Volga and Vyatka Project 15310 cable ships near the Zatoka shipyard, the Petropavlovsk cargo and passenger ferry, and an S-400 air defense system radar station near occupied Kerch.
Ukrainian long-range drone strikes hit Russia's military supply vessels in the city of Kerch and air defense systems in the Kerch Strait area in occupied Crimea, Ukraine's Security Service (SBU) said on June 26.
SBU drones struck Russian military support vessels and an S-400 air defense system in occupied Kerch as part of a newly launched 40-day operation in Crimea approved by President Volodymyr Zelensky.
Ukrainian drones attacked Kerch, causing a fire near the Pantsir-S1 air defense system and aerodrome.
